Choosing between Mistral Small 3 and GPT-4o-mini comes down to what matters most in your workload: raw response speed, deployment flexibility, multimodal capability, or API economics.
Two numbers stand out immediately. Mistral Small 3 is a 24B-parameter model that processes 150 tokens per second and reaches over 81% on MMLU. GPT-4o-mini scores 82% on MMLU, supports a 128K-token context window with up to 16K output tokens per request, and is priced at 15 cents per million input tokens and 60 cents per million output tokens.
For buyers comparing Mistral Small 3 vs GPT-4o-mini, the practical split is clear: Mistral Small 3 emphasizes low-latency language performance and local deployment, while GPT-4o-mini emphasizes low-cost API usage, long context, and text-and-vision support.
Mistral Small 3 is a 24B AI model optimized for efficiency, speed, and low latency in language processing tasks. It is designed for developers who need rapid responses, quick and reliable AI capabilities, local deployment options, and fast function execution.
The model achieves over 81% accuracy on MMLU and processes 150 tokens per second. Mistral positions it as a highly efficient, latency-optimized AI model for fast language tasks.
Mistral also supports a broader product environment around its models, including Studio for building and running AI agents and apps, Forge for training and evaluating custom models, and enterprise-oriented deployment and customization services.
GPT-4o-mini is OpenAI’s most cost-efficient small model. It is built for affordable, low-latency intelligence across a broad range of applications, especially workflows that chain or parallelize multiple model calls, use large amounts of context, or deliver fast customer-facing responses.
GPT-4o-mini scores 82% on MMLU. It supports text and vision in the API today, with text, image, video, and audio inputs and outputs planned. It also offers a 128K-token context window, supports up to 16K output tokens per request, and includes strong benchmark results in coding, math, and multimodal reasoning.

Mistral Small 3’s biggest advantage is speed-oriented language performance. A throughput figure of 150 tokens per second is directly useful for latency-sensitive assistants, internal copilots, and workflows where every model call needs to return quickly.
GPT-4o-mini’s biggest advantage is breadth. It combines strong MMLU performance with long context, text-and-vision support, large output capacity, and benchmark strength in coding and math. That makes it especially attractive for teams building one API-backed model layer across several use cases.

GPT-4o-mini is the easier product to quantify on price: 15 cents per million input tokens and 60 cents per million output tokens. OpenAI positions that as an order-of-magnitude improvement over previous frontier models and more than 60% cheaper than GPT-3.5 Turbo.
For Mistral Small 3, the pricing conversation is more closely tied to how you want to deploy it. Buyers evaluating total cost should weigh API usage against the value of local deployment, lower latency operation, and fit with Mistral’s enterprise deployment and customization options.
Mistral Small 3 is tuned for quick interactions. If your product experience depends on fast turn-taking, short wait times, and reliable language execution, its latency-optimized profile is a strong operational fit.
It also benefits buyers who want model flexibility beyond a single hosted endpoint. Mistral supports developers with Studio, API access, cookbooks, and enterprise deployment paths, which is useful for teams moving from prototype to production while keeping infrastructure options open.
GPT-4o-mini is designed for developers who want affordable intelligence at scale through an API. OpenAI specifically frames it for workflows like parallel model calls, customer support chatbots, and large-context processing such as full code bases or long conversation histories.
Its support for text and vision broadens the types of applications you can build from the start. For teams standardizing on one small model across chat, extraction, coding, and multimodal tasks, that can simplify implementation.

Mistral Small 3 is centered on efficient, low-latency language processing and local deployment. GPT-4o-mini is centered on cost-efficient API usage, long context, and text-and-vision support.
Mistral Small 3 has a published throughput figure of 150 tokens per second and is explicitly optimized for low latency. GPT-4o-mini is also positioned for low-latency use, but its standout published strengths are cost efficiency, long context, and multimodal capability.
GPT-4o-mini has stronger published benchmark detail for coding and math, including 87.2% on HumanEval and 87.0% on MGSM. Mistral Small 3 is still compelling for technical workflows that depend more on fast text generation and rapid function execution.
Mistral Small 3 is the stronger choice for local deployment because it is explicitly intended for that use case. That makes it particularly relevant for teams with infrastructure control, data handling, or latency requirements tied to self-managed environments.
GPT-4o-mini has clear API pricing at 15 cents per million input tokens and 60 cents per million output tokens. That makes it very straightforward to model API spend for high-volume applications.
